Output 395962d51292b01b0bb62c3100a30c6503b3eeb334b5577ce7a9aef06fbf5304:2

value
505990
script pubkey
OP_0 OP_PUSHBYTES_20 245203dd0240f7ec19c71e8a00c303ec686661d4
address
bc1qy3fq8hgzgrm7cxw8r69qpscra35xvcw57a2449
transaction
395962d51292b01b0bb62c3100a30c6503b3eeb334b5577ce7a9aef06fbf5304